Use the 'Bank Jump' function on your Morningstar MIDI controller to create an efficient navigation system with song and set lists. It's simple and quick to do. We show you exactly how in this short video! Visit us at morningstar.io.

    Hi. Glad to hear you're enjoying your MC8! From 3 August 2021, we moved to LCD screens with white backgrounds for the MC8. The Quality Control reject rate of the previous black ones was getting too high and we could not continue to use them. We changed all our product photos to reflect this change in color as well. Since then we've also had some customers ask how they can change their black screens to white (and vice versa). The white text on dark background was cool but the QC rejection rate was something we could no longer accept.

    3 жыл бұрын

    Hi. You need to exit Editor mode for it to work. Click on 'Disconnect Device' first. It's designed this way to ensure ease of use when editing.
